Sure the argument can be made that its up to the consumer to redeem the titles themselves, it isn't exactly a large time investment. However, I think most of us can relate that having several subscriptions to various services be it video streaming or game related, it's very easy to forget you even have these things to redeem on a monthly basis.
I think it's absurd and borderline anti-consumer that if you've already been paying for these services that neither Sony or Microsoft can't seemingly implement a system that automatically posts these licenses to your account. The ability to redeem these is included in the subscription cost, so why is it necessary to do it manually? We're all a bit forgetful at certain times, and it feels like a bit of a cheat to not be able to redeem titles because you missed an arbitrary window. If you're enrolled in a service, be it X-Box Live or PS Plus, for whichever month these titles are offered, you should be able to redeem them whenever.
Admittedly part of this is some personal salt at having recently picked up a PS5 and not being able to redeem PS Plus titles like Bugsnax and Worms Rumble after the months they were offered, when I was already paying for my PS Plus sub for those months.
At least with something like Epic Games Store the freebies aren't tied to any investment or subscription, so can't say I'm bothered if I miss redeeming one of those.
